Why You Need a Car Accident Attorney
18 July 2025 | 0 comments | Posted by Tod Malicoat in Petrol heads
Car accidents can have a significant impact on your life by causing you emotional trauma, physical injuries, and numerous financial problems. Whether you have faced a minor accident or a major one, it will be tough for you to deal with its impacts.
A reliable and knowledgeable car accident attorney can help you a lot in dealing with these kinds of burdens. A professional lawyer will not only help you in protecting your legal rights but also in getting the right amount of compensation you deserve for your sufferings.
To deal with the aftermath of a car accident, a car accident attorney can play a crucial role in getting the preferred outcome or the best compensation for your specific case.
Why Insurance Companies Aren't on Your Side
One of the biggest misconceptions accident victims have is believing that insurance companies will treat them fairly. The reality is that insurance companies—even your own—are profit-driven businesses with a vested interest in paying out as little as possible on claims.
Insurance adjusters are trained negotiators who use specific tactics to minimize settlements. They may contact you shortly after the accident when you're still in pain and vulnerable, hoping to get you to accept a quick settlement before you fully understand the extent of your injuries or damages. They might ask you to provide recorded statements that could later be used against you, or request access to your medical records far beyond what's necessary for your claim.
These companies also have vast resources at their disposal. They employ investigators who will scrutinize every aspect of your case looking for ways to reduce their liability. They have access to accident reconstruction experts, medical professionals who may downplay your injuries, and surveillance teams that might monitor your activities to contradict your claims.
Without legal representation, you're essentially bringing a knife to a gunfight. An experienced car accident attorney levels the playing field by understanding these tactics and having the resources to counter them effectively.
The True Cost of Car Accident Injuries
Many accident victims significantly underestimate the full financial impact of their injuries. The immediate costs—emergency room visits, initial medical treatments, and vehicle repairs—are just the tip of the iceberg.
Medical Expenses Go Beyond the Obvious
Your medical costs may include ongoing treatment, physical therapy, prescription medications, medical equipment, and potentially lifelong care for severe injuries. Future medical expenses are often the largest component of injury settlements, but they require expert analysis to properly calculate.
Lost Income and Earning Capacity
Beyond immediate lost wages, serious injuries can affect your long-term earning capacity. You might need to change careers, work fewer hours, or require accommodations that limit your advancement opportunities. These economic losses can amount to hundreds of thousands of dollars over a lifetime.
Non-Economic Damages
Pain and suffering, emotional distress, loss of enjoyment of life, and relationship impacts are real damages that deserve compensation. However, calculating these non-economic damages requires legal expertise and understanding of how courts and juries typically value such losses.
Property Damage and Other Costs
Vehicle replacement or repair costs, rental car expenses, and other out-of-pocket costs add up quickly. Sometimes there's diminished value to your vehicle even after repairs, which you may be entitled to recover.
How Car Accident Attorneys Maximize Your Recovery
An experienced car accident attorney brings numerous advantages to your case that can significantly impact your final settlement or verdict.
Thorough Investigation and Evidence Collection
Attorneys have the resources and expertise to conduct comprehensive investigations. They can obtain police reports, interview witnesses, work with accident reconstruction experts, and preserve crucial evidence that might otherwise be lost or destroyed. This thorough approach often uncovers additional liable parties or evidence that strengthens your case.
Accurate Damage Calculation
Calculating the full value of your claim requires expertise in medical costs, economic analysis, and legal precedents. Attorneys work with medical experts, economists, and life care planners to ensure all your damages are properly documented and valued.
Skilled Negotiation
Insurance companies take attorney-represented claims more seriously. Experienced attorneys understand the true value of cases and won't accept lowball offers. They know how to negotiate effectively and when to push for better terms.
Trial Preparedness
While most cases settle out of court, insurance companies are more likely to offer fair settlements when they know you have an attorney prepared to take the case to trial if necessary. This trial readiness provides significant leverage in negotiations.
Understanding of Legal Deadlines and Procedures
Every state has specific statutes of limitations and procedural requirements for car accident cases. Missing these deadlines can forever bar your right to compensation. Attorneys ensure all requirements are met and deadlines are observed.
When You Especially Need Legal Representation
While any injury accident benefits from legal representation, certain situations make hiring an attorney absolutely critical. Severe or Permanent Injuries
Cases involving significant injuries, disabilities, or long-term medical treatment require sophisticated legal and medical analysis. The stakes are simply too high to handle these cases without expert help. Disputed Liability
When the other party or their insurance company disputes who was at fault, you need someone who can investigate the accident, gather evidence, and build a compelling case proving liability. Multiple Parties Involved
Multi-vehicle accidents or cases involving commercial vehicles, government entities, or other complex liability situations require legal expertise to identify all responsible parties and navigate multiple insurance policies. Inadequate Insurance Coverage
When the at-fault party has insufficient insurance to cover your damages, an attorney can explore other sources of compensation, including your own underinsured motorist coverage. Insurance Company Bad Faith
If an insurance company is unreasonably delaying, denying, or undervaluing your claim, you may have grounds for a bad faith lawsuit, which requires legal expertise to pursue effectively.
The Financial Reality: Can You Afford NOT to Hire an Attorney?
Many accident victims worry about attorney fees, but this concern is often misplaced. Most car accident att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you recover compensation.
This arrangement aligns the attorney's interests with yours and makes quality legal representation accessible regardless of your financial situation.
Studies consistently show that accident victims who hire attorneys recover significantly more compensation than those who handle cases themselves, even after accounting for attorney fees. The Insurance Research Council found that injury victims who hired attorneys recovered 3.5 times more compensation than those who didn't.
Consider this: if you settle your case for $30,000 on your own, but an attorney could have secured a $100,000 settlement, you've actually lost $40,000 by not hiring legal representation, even after paying attorney fees.
What to Look for in a Car Accident Attorney
Not all attorneys are created equal, and choosing the right representation can make a significant difference in your case outcome.
Experience and Specialization
Look for attorneys who specialize in car accident cases and have extensive experience handling cases similar to yours. Ask about their track record, including recent settlements and verdicts. Resources and Support
Successful car accident cases often require significant resources for investigation, expert witnesses, and case preparation. Ensure your attorney has the financial resources and support staff necessary to handle your case effectively.
Communication and Accessibility
You want an attorney who will keep you informed about your case progress and be available to answer your questions. During initial consultations, pay attention to how well they communicate and whether they seem genuinely interested in your case.
Reputation and References
Research the attorney's reputation in the legal community and among past clients. Online reviews, peer ratings, and client testimonials can provide valuable insights.
They Come with Expertise
Car accident lawyers possess the requisite knowledge and expertise in this field. They have information about the traffic laws and other laws related to the injury you may face.
A car accident attorney will thoroughly understand the complexities of the documentation required to obtain the claim amount, including deadlines and legal procedures. They have been doing the same work for several years, which has enabled them to become experts in navigating the tactics of insurance companies and handling legal procedures.
A trusted car accident attorney from San Diego can make sure that your rights are being protected by law and will handle your case professionally.
Help You with Compensation
It is the most prominent reason why you should hire a car accident attorney for yourself because they will help you obtain the maximum amount of compensation that you will require in the present and future while dealing with the complications.
Most people are unaware of the potential expenses they will incur shortly, and will demand compensation based on their current medical expenses.
A professional car accident attorney will help you make a rough estimation of the amount of compensation based on your present and future expenses. They have dealt with too many cases of a similar type, which means they know about all the possible future expenses that you may bear.
Taking Action: The Importance of Acting Quickly
Time is critical in car accident cases. Evidence disappears, witnesses' memories fade, and legal deadlines approach. The sooner you consult with an attorney, the better they can protect your interests and build your case.
Many attorneys offer free consultations, so there's no financial risk in getting professional advice about your situation. Even if you're unsure whether you need legal representation, a consultation can help you understand your rights and options.
